‘As a child, he suffered a lot of hardship and neglect, so he’s had to overcome those obstacles entirely on his own. He’s a lone wolf – the black sheep of the family who has made a name for himself.

‘He’s addicted to success and the finer things in life, but there’s a real vulnerability there, too. It’s the first time I’ve played a character where I can show that side, which is a great gift for an actor.’

‘He’s used to flashy people, but when he sees Leanne fending off a group of guys who aren’t paying their bill, he sees a strength in her that he admires. It reminds him of his own mother, who raised him as a single parent. He sees a strength in Leanne that he probably wishes he’d had in his own life.

‘Working with Jane Danson has been amazing; even on her day off, she came in to meet me. She’s really made this experience special.’
